· Develop and implement comprehensive PDN analysis methodologies for complex 3DIC packages, including CPU, GPU, and TPU structures.
· Perform detailed power noise and signal integrity simulations using tools like Cadence Sigrity PowerSI, Ansys HFSS, or equivalent.
· Identify and resolve power integrity issues, such as IR drop, ground bounce, and signal noise, to achieve sign-off criteria.
· Analyze and optimize signal integrity for high-speed interfaces in 3DIC packages, including HBM3, UCIE, and DDR5.
· Perform advanced SI simulations using industry-standard tools like Cadence Clarity, HyperLynx, Ansys HFSS, or equivalent.
· Extract parasitic from 3D package layout and integrate them into SI simulations.
· Develop and implement design rules and guidelines for 3DIC package signal integrity.
· Collaborate with design engineers, layout engineers, and thermal engineers to optimize the PDN design and ensure proper heat dissipation.
· Stay up-to-date on emerging 3DIC technologies and trends and propose innovative solutions to improve power integrity performance.
· Document analysis results and findings clearly and concisely for internal and external stakeholders.
· Participate in technical discussions and provide expert guidance on signal/power integrity matters.

Cadence enables electronic systems and semiconductor companies to create the innovative end products that are transforming the way people live, work and play. Cadence® software, hardware and IP are used by customers to deliver products to market faster. The company's Intelligent System Design strategy helps customers develop differentiated products—from chips to boards to intelligent systems—in mobile, consumer, cloud, data center, automotive, aerospace, IoT, industrial and other market segments.
